#a1eb1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a1eb1e is composed of 63.1% red, 92.2%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 81.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 52%. #a1eb1e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3c with #43d700.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#a1eb1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a1eb1e has RGB values of R:161, G:235,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 10611486.

Shades and Tints of #a1eb1e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060901 is the darkest color, while #fbf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a1eb1e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878d7c is the less saturated color, while #a6fe0b is the most saturated one.
